About the role
Join the Deputy Chief Risk Officer team in the role of Senior Specialist, ORSA (Own Risk and Solvency Assessment). In this role, you will lead a variety of assignments to support own risk and solvency assessment (ORSA) process. You will monitor risk limits (including but not limited to insurance, credit, market and liquidity risk etc.), prepare risk insights (e.g. reports on stress testing and ORSA results) and author management material (i.e. memos, decks, documentation) to management, senior executive committees and to the Board. Additionally, you will develop capabilities to oversee risks including working with stakeholders to implement the methodology, metrics, and program standards for the assigned portfolio to ensure compliance and effective monitoring and timely reporting.
Responsibilities:
WHAT YOU’LL DO:
- Lead own risk and solvency assessment process; design, develop and produce management risk reports and memos for various working groups and committees. Prepare risk reports and analysis in response to ad-hoc requests.
- Monitor the financial market and economic environment and assess the impacts on capital requirement.
- Independently administers and evaluates models, model assumptions, and key metrics used for the measurement of risk for adherence to all policies and procedures applicable to the transaction based on established processes, documents and reports results of evaluations on an individual and summary basis.
- Develop and maintain in-depth knowledge of business and related risk management requirements, industry standards and legislative/ regulatory directives and guidance.
- Work independently and regularly handle highly complex situations. Broader work or accountabilities may be assigned as needed.
- Identify emerging issues and trends to inform decision-making.
